JEE Advanced Result 2025: The result of JEE Advanced 2025, conducted for admission to the prestigious engineering institute IIT, has been released today. Candidates can check their scorecard by visiting the official website jeeadv.ac.in. Also, the final answer key has been released. A total of more than 1 lakh 90 thousand students had registered for the exam. The exam was of a total of 360 marks, in which both Paper-1 and Paper-2 were of 180-180 marks.

In this prestigious exam, Rajit Gupta of IIT Delhi Zone performed brilliantly and secured All India Rank 1 (AIR 1) by securing 332 marks. At the same time, Devdatta Majhi of IIT Kharagpur Zone has won the title of female topper with AIR 16. Click here to see the topper list...

JEE Advanced 2025 Cutoff

The cutoff of JEE Advanced 2025 has also been released in percentage form so that it is easy for the candidates to understand how much percentage of the total marks they were required to score. This year the minimum cutoff for the Common Rank List (CRL) has been 20.56%. At the same time, this cutoff has been fixed at 18.50% for the OBC-NCL and General EWS categories. This minimum qualifying percentage for SC and ST category candidates was 10.28%. Based on this cutoff, candidates can evaluate their eligibility and prepare to participate in the further counseling process.

Category Cutoff Percentage (%)
Common Rank List (CRL) 20.56%
OBC-NCL 18.50%
GEN-EWS 18.50%
SC 10.28%
ST 10.28%
The JEE Advanced exam was held on 18 May
This year JEE Advanced exam was conducted on 18 May in two shifts. This exam was conducted at a total of 224 examination centers including 222 cities of the country as well as Kathmandu and Dubai. JEE Advanced 2025 was organized by IIT Kanpur this time.

Counseling will be done in six phases.
This year the admission process will be conducted in 23 IITs, 32 NITs, 26 Triple ITs, and 47 GFTI institutes across the country through JoSAA Counseling 2025. This entire process will be completed in online mode. Counseling will be conducted in a total of six phases from June 3 to July 28.

To participate in this, candidates will have to register online and fill out college choices by visiting the official website of JoSAA from June 3 to June 12 at 5 pm. The first phase seat allotment list will be released on June 14. Candidates who will be allotted seats in the first round will have to confirm their seats by reporting online by June 19 and paying the seat acceptance fee.

After this, in the remaining phases of counseling, the seat allotment of the second round will be released on June 21, the third round on June 28, the fourth round on July 4, the fifth round on July 10, and the final sixth round on July 16.

20 percent of girls' seats in IIT and NIT

Girls will get admission on 20 percent additional seats in IIT and NIT. There is no reduction in other reserved seats due to these additional seats. Its purpose is to connect daughters with the premium engineering institutes of the country.
